TRAPPER MINING INC. <br />P.O. Box 187 Craig, Colorado 81626 (970) 824-4401 <br />February 26, 2018 <br />Ms. Robin Reilley <br />RECEIVED <br />Environmental Protection Specialist FEB 2 7 2018 <br />Colorado Division of Reclamation, Mining and Safety <br />1313 Sherman Street, Room 215 <br />Denver, CO 80203 Division of Reclamation, <br />Mining & Safety <br />Re: Trapper Miming %, Permit No. C-1"14110, Te&Wcd 1kiddoa T11419 <br />Update to the 2018 Mine and Reclamation Ptan <br />Dear Ms. Reilley: <br />Please find enclosed duplicate copies of Technical Revision TR -119. This revision is intended to <br />update the 2018 mining and reclamation plan as an interim step in advance of the submittal of <br />Permit Revision No. 9 (PR9) that will include a more comprehensive mining and reclamation <br />plan update for the 2018-2022 permit term. Included with this application are updates to several <br />pages of permit text, along with several revised maps. <br />The following revised permit narrative pages are enclosed: 3-13, 3-15, 3-15a and 3-15b. The <br />following revised maps are enclosed: M9 (sheets 2 and 3), M10A (sheet 3) and M10B (sheets 2 <br />and 3). <br />Page 3-13 (Table 3.1-3) is revised to include 2018 projected disturbance, reclamation and bond <br />release acreages and the resultant impacts to these numbers. Revised pages 3-15 and 3-15a update <br />Section 3.1.4.1- Mining Sequence — particularly for L and N Pits, which will be the only two <br />active pits during 2018. Page 3-15b updates Section 3.1.4.2 — Highwall Mining — primarily <br />discussing future (beyond 2018) highwall mining potential in L and N Pits. <br />Proposed 2018 stripping will include 84.0 acres of new disturbance in L -Pit and 161.4 acres of re - <br />disturbance of Phase III reclamation in the N -Pit area. This is a total of 245.4 acres of <br />disturbance. <br />Map M9 — Haulroads Map — will show a proposed new road to access N Pit and removal of <br />certain other haulroads that have been reclaimed. Map M10A is revised to include 2018 proposed <br />mining areas and 2018 proposed regraded areas. Map M10B is revised to include 2018 proposed <br />topsoil removal and 2018 proposed reclaimed areas. You will note that regraded/reclaimed areas <br />are juxtaposed over the top of M-10 maps that are current for PR -7, as modified for TR -115, and <br />overlap projected regrade/reclamation for previous years. The M-10 maps will be totally updated <br />with the upcoming submittal of PR -9 and any apparent confusion will be clarified. <br />Our current Performance Bond is based on the worst case reclamation year of 2014. The open <br />acres estimate for 2014 was 2,122.3. In 2018, Trapper is anticipating ending the year with 2,073.7 <br />open acres, which is 48.6 acres less than 2014. This should leave adequate bond for the interim. <br />
